.login{
    padding-right: 0 !important;
  }

 .login h2{
    text-align: center;
  }

 .login p{
  margin: 0 10% 0 10%;
  }  

  .form-type-material{
    margin-left: 10%;
    margin-right: 10%;
  }

  div.form-group.flexbox{
    width: 80%;
    margin-left: 4%;
  }

/* #mainContent div label{
    margin-left: 20px !important;
} */

.ant-table-body{
    overflow: auto;
}

.ant-table-thead > tr > th, .ant-table-tbody > tr > td {
    padding: 16px 16px;
    word-break: unset !important; 
}

th.ant-table-column-has-actions.ant-table-column-has-filters div{
    width: max-content;
}
.ant-table-bordered .ant-table-thead > tr > th, .ant-table-bordered .ant-table-tbody > tr > td {
    text-align: center;
    border-right: 1px solid #e8e8e8;
}
/*
.cart-title .flexbox{
    width: 100%;
    display:block !important;
}*/



/*
button.btn.btn-sm.btn-success {
    margin-left: 5px !important; 
}


.modal-dialog .modal-content{
    width: 100% !important;
    right: 0px !important;
}*/

.w-20px {
    width: 40px !important;
}

/*
tr td div input{
    width: 100% !important;
}*/


@media (max-width: 520px){
    
    /*
    button.btn.btn-sm.btn-success, button.btn.btn-sm.btn-create {
        margin-left: unset !important; 
    }

    .btn-success {
        background-color: #15c377;
        border-color: #15c377;
        color: #fff;
        width: 100%;
        margin-bottom: 5px;
    }

    .btn-create {
        background-color: #ED383C;
        color: #fff;
        border-style: none;
        width: 100%;
    }

    form.form-inline .form-group.mb-2{
        width: 100% !important;
    }
    
    .form-inline .form-group.mx-sm-3.mb-2{
        width: 100% !important;
    }

    .form-inline .form-group {
        margin-right: 0.5rem !important;
    }

    /*
    .modal-dialog .modal-content{
        width: 100% !important;
        right: 0px !important;
    }*/

    .w-20px {
        width: 40px !important;
    }

    /*
    tr td div input{
        width: 100% !important;
    }*/

    .table td, .table th {
         padding: 0rem !important; 
    }

}
